Paul Evans Pewter Pitcher/Vessel

By Crosby0605, 11 August, 2012
Description

Paul Evans (1931-1987) Pitcher
Pewter and rosewood
Massachusetts and Hope, Pennsylvania, mid-20th century
Tapering elongated oval vessel/pitcher with elongated spout, rosewood plaque and pewter handle, impressed P EVANS Pewter on base, ht. 12 in.

The smaller piece is not marked but matches the piece exactly.  Both pieces have minor scuffs.  Pitcher has two small chips on the rosewood.

Research has said that these pitchers were early works of Paul Evans, while he was working at Sturbridge
